An efficient way to scrap dishes and pre rinse them.  The ScrapMaster is completely processing these trays for washing.  It is removing all food to a very strong 5HP disposal and pre rinsing the trays so they are dishmachine ready in one step.  Of course it will work just as well for a restaurant.  Imagine how fast dishes could make it to and through the dishmachine if the scrapping and pre rinse process were automated.

Yes it does recirculate the water:

whirlykenmore78's profile picture

The water flume gushes at 30  GPM the system uses 7GPM.  This includes water to feed the disposer.
